TERMS OF USE 1. Driver Age and License Requirements To rent a vehicle, the driver must be at least 21 years old and must hold a valid driver's license for a minimum of 6 months. 2. Vehicle Use and Authorized Drivers The vehicle may also be driven by other persons accompanying the primary (registered) driver, **provided that the primary driver named in the rental agreement is present in the vehicle as a passenger**. If the primary driver is not present in the vehicle, transferring or allowing the use of the vehicle by any third party not included in the rental agreement is strictly prohibited. 3. Insurance and Collision Damage Coverage Compulsory Third-Party Liability Insurance: All rented vehicles are provided with compulsory third-party liability insurance as standard and at no additional cost. In the event of an accident, this insurance covers material damage and bodily injury caused to third parties within the applicable legal limits. Collision Damage Coverage with €800 Excess: Damage that may occur to the rented vehicle is covered under collision damage insurance subject to an €800 excess. At-Fault Accidents: If the renter/driver is found to be at fault in an accident, the renter is responsible for the first €800 of the damage caused to the rented vehicle. Any repair and damage costs exceeding €800 are covered by the insurance. Not-at-Fault Accidents: If the other party is determined to be fully at fault and this is documented by an official accident report or a police/gendarmerie report, no amount, including the €800 excess, will be charged to the renter. The full damage amount will be recovered from the responsible party's insurance. Circumstances Where Insurance Coverage Becomes Invalid All insurance and collision damage coverage shall become invalid in the following circumstances: Failure to obtain the required police/gendarmerie accident report immediately following an accident, or failure to obtain the required alcohol/drug test report, Driving the vehicle under the influence of alcohol, drugs, or other intoxicating substances, Use of the vehicle by unauthorized persons while the primary registered driver is not present in the vehicle, Exceeding speed limits, participating in racing activities, carrying excessive loads or passengers, or using the vehicle for illegal activities. In such cases, the renter shall be fully responsible for all resulting losses, damages, and costs. 4. Fuel Policy Vehicles must be returned with the same fuel level as at the time of collection. If the vehicle is returned with less fuel, the cost of the missing fuel will be charged to the renter. 5. General Responsibilities All traffic fines, bridge tolls, motorway charges, and parking fees incurred during the rental period are the responsibility of the renter. The renter is required to use the vehicle with due care and in compliance with all applicable traffic laws and regulations.
